If the internal rate of return is used as the discount rate in the net present value calculations, the net present value will be equal to zero. The internal rate of return (IRR) is a financial analysis metric used to estimate the profitability of potential investments.
The IRR calculations use the same formula as NPV calculations. Keep in mind that the IRR is not the project's actual the dollar value. The annual return is what brings the NPV to zero. The IRR is calculated in the same way as net present value (NPV), except that it sets NPV to zero.

There are many types of indorsements, and out of them one is "Trust Indorsement"
Trust Indorsement is an indorsement to a person who can use the funds for the benefit of the indorser.
Example:
Brian indorses a check to his employee Denny "Payable to Denny, as agent for Brian", This is an example of trust indorsment.
Option b and c are clearly examples of trust indorsements in which you can notice that Rao has indorsed his lawyer and accountant "as agent for Rao".
Whereas, option a is NOT a trust indorsment but rather a "Blank Indorsement"
Blank Indorsment is an indorsement that doesn't have any particular indorsee and only has a signature on it.
